Stansted Transportation: The Complete Guide to Getting To and From the Airport

V Class Executive Taxi Transfers

Stansted records around 30 million passengers a year, with a heavy focus on European low-cost carriers, making it one of the busiest airports in the country for short-haul city breaks. It’s well served by rail links into London, but working out the right transportation option for your journey isn’t always obvious, particularly with luggage, an early flight, or a group travelling together. Here’s how the main options compare.

Rail Options: Stansted Express and Greater Anglia

The Stansted Express runs a fast, direct service to London Liverpool Street, with Greater Anglia services also connecting to other parts of the network. These are efficient for a single traveller with light luggage, but they require getting to and from stations at both ends, which adds complexity for anyone not starting or ending their journey in central London.

Coaches and Buses

National Express and other operators run coach services from Stansted to towns and cities across the country, along with routes into central London. They’re a budget-friendly option, but slower and less flexible than a direct transfer, with no door-to-door element and a real risk of missing a connecting service if your flight lands late.

Standard Taxis and Ride-Hailing Apps

Taxis are available at the terminal, and ride-hailing apps offer another option. The downside is price unpredictability, with fares that can climb during busy periods, particularly around Stansted’s frequent early-morning and late-night low-cost carrier schedules.

Stansted’s Single Terminal Layout

Unlike Heathrow or Gatwick, Stansted operates through a single terminal, which simplifies the drop-off and pickup process considerably. There’s no risk of being taken to the wrong building, just a straightforward journey to the one terminal serving all airlines.
